## Runbook: Receipt Mailer Backlog — Almsworth Platform

If donation receipts queue past 30 minutes, first check the templating worker pool, not the SMTP relay — nine times out of ten a malformed campaign template stalls the renderer. Drain the poison message to the dead-letter queue, then restart workers two at a time to preserve ordering guarantees. Confirm receipts resume before closing the incident. Record the deploy in question using the build token below.

session token of tajef-bageg = htk21_5d90d574934f3ccae6437

Contractors scheduled to work during this window must have their visits pre-approved by their site sponsor and recorded in the holiday access register held at reception. Please plan deliveries and equipment collection accordingly, as no staff will be present to assist. Out-of-hours entry during this period is via the north door, using the code below.

staff pass of kawip-hawef = bdg-QLP-2

Subject: Quickstore 4.2 — bloom filter now fronts the KV layer

Plugin authors: starting with this release, Quickstore places a bloom filter ahead of the key-value store. Negative lookups return faster; false positives fall through safely. No API changes are required on your side. Verify your plugin against the staging build referenced below.

session token of fahif-tadup = htk3_9c7